Movie Overview: Yeh Dil Aashiqana (2002) Director: Kuku Kohli Cast: Karan Nath, Jividha Sharma, Rajat Bedi, Aditya Pancholi Genre: Romance / Action Release Date: January 18, 2002 The film follows the story of Karan and Pooja, two college students who fall in love. However, their romance takes a dark turn when Pooja’s brother, a notorious terrorist, opposes their union. The film was noted for blending a traditional love story with the high-stakes tension of a hijack thriller. often found on file-sharing sites, or more broadly, its complete profile spanning plot, cast, and music Yeh Dil Aashiqanaa is a 2002 Bollywood romantic action thriller that gained a cult following primarily for its hit soundtrack. Film Overview Release Date: January 18, 2002. Kuku Kohli. Main Cast: Karan Nath (Karan), Jividha Sharma (Pooja), and Aditya Pancholi (Akhmash Jalaal). A "treacle-and-terrorism" blend of campus romance and high-stakes action. Plot Summary The story follows Karan and Pooja , two college students in Pune who fall in love. The plot takes a dramatic turn when Pooja’s flight is hijacked by terrorists. Karan successfully rescues her, only to discover that the hijacking was orchestrated by Pooja's own brother, Vijay , who is secretly allied with the terrorist leader Akhmash. The film culminates in a "cat and mouse" chase as the couple attempts to escape both the terrorists and Pooja's brother. Musical Success The film's most enduring legacy is its music, composed by Nadeem-Shravan .
